Product Information

4-Nitrobenzonitrile is a versatile chemical compound widely utilized in the synthesis of various organic compounds, particularly in the pharmaceutical and agrochemical industries. This compound, characterized by its nitro and nitrile functional groups, serves as a key intermediate in the production of dyes, pharmaceuticals, and agrochemicals. Its unique structure allows for the introduction of diverse functional groups, making it an essential building block for researchers and manufacturers looking to create complex molecules.

In addition to its role in organic synthesis, 4-Nitrobenzonitrile is also employed in the development of specialty chemicals and materials. Its properties, such as stability under various conditions and reactivity with nucleophiles, make it suitable for applications in medicinal chemistry and materials science. Researchers have leveraged its potential in the design of novel compounds with enhanced biological activity, showcasing its importance in advancing chemical research and development.

Synonyms
4-Cyanonitrobenzene
CAS Number
619-72-7
Purity
≥ 98% (GC)
Molecular Formula
C7H4N2O2
Molecular Weight
148.12
MDL Number
MFCD00007279
PubChem ID
12090
Melting Point
142 - 146 ?C
Appearance
Light yellow crystals
Conditions
Store at RT

Applications

4-Nitrobenzonitrile is widely utilized in research focused on:

  • Synthesis of Pharmaceuticals: This compound serves as an important intermediate in the synthesis of various pharmaceutical agents, particularly those targeting neurological disorders.
  • Organic Synthesis: It is commonly used in organic chemistry for the preparation of other complex molecules, allowing researchers to create diverse chemical structures efficiently.
  • Material Science: The compound is applied in the development of advanced materials, including polymers and coatings, due to its unique chemical properties that enhance material performance.
  • Analytical Chemistry: 4-Nitrobenzonitrile is utilized as a standard in analytical methods, aiding in the calibration of instruments and ensuring accurate measurements in various chemical analyses.
  • Environmental Studies: It plays a role in environmental research, particularly in the study of pollutant degradation and the development of methods to assess chemical toxicity.
